Why Solar Works in Lethbridge

Lethbridge sits at latitude 49.7 degrees and averages 2,463 peak sun hours per year, which puts it ahead of every other major Canadian city for solar production. That's not marketing copy. It's a number derived from decades of weather station data, and it matters when you're sizing a system for a shop or outbuilding that runs compressors, welders, and lighting year-round. A 12 kW system in this area produces an estimated 16,057 kWh annually. At Alberta's 2025 average power rate of $0.18 per kWh, that's roughly $2,890 in avoided energy costs every year. The City of Lethbridge operates its own electric utility, so interconnection applications go through the city rather than a major provincial wire service. Approval typically takes two to six weeks. The deregulated Alberta electricity market means your rate can swing month to month, and locking in solar production now offsets a larger share of your bill when rates spike. For shops with high daytime loads like pumps, fans, or HVAC systems, that offset happens right when you need it most.

Rural Electrical Service in Lethbridge: What You Need to Know

Voltage Rise

Voltage rise happens when solar generation pushes electricity back toward the grid along a distribution line that already sits near the top of its operating voltage range. On longer rural lines, this effect is more pronounced because line impedance increases with distance from the substation. If voltage rise is significant at your service point, inverters will throttle output or shut down to stay within utility limits, which reduces the system's actual production relative to what the panel nameplate suggests.

Single-Phase vs Three-Phase

Most residential and light farm services in rural Alberta are single-phase, which is fine for homes, heated shops, and smaller outbuildings. Properties with grain handling equipment, large irrigation pivots, or commercial cold storage often have three-phase service, which changes how we spec the inverter string and what system capacity the service can support. We confirm your phase configuration during the site assessment before the design goes any further.

Panel Infrastructure

Older electrical panels on acreages and farm properties sometimes don't have the breaker capacity to accommodate a solar backfeed breaker alongside the existing loads. We check the panel's main breaker rating, available breaker slots, and the age of the equipment during the site review. If the panel needs upgrading to support the system, we'll include that scope in the proposal so the cost is clear before you commit.

Service Entrance Review

The meter base and service entrance are the first things the City of Lethbridge Electric Utility looks at when reviewing a micro-generation application. We inspect the meter base condition, the weatherhead, and the grounding during our site visit. If the meter base is damaged or doesn't meet current utility standards, it needs to be replaced before the application will be approved, and we'd rather catch that in the design phase than after the paperwork is submitted.

Right-Sizing Solar for Lethbridge Properties

Rural properties around Lethbridge often carry two or three separate electrical loads on the same meter: a house, a heated shop, and sometimes a grain handling setup or irrigation system. That stack of loads changes everything about how we size a solar system. A home on its own might be a 10 kW job. Add a 40x60 heated shop and you're probably looking at 16 kW minimum. Add a pivot or a grain dryer and you're designing something closer to 20 kW. The roof versus ground-mount decision usually comes down to three factors: roof condition, available roof area facing south, and what else is on the property. A steel shop roof with good south exposure is often the cleanest option. But if the roof is shaded by a neighbouring shelter belt, has a low pitch that doesn't drain snow well, or simply doesn't have enough square footage for the array you need, a ground mount in an open area of the yard makes more sense. Ground mounts also let us tilt panels at the optimal angle for this latitude, which squeezes a bit more production out of each panel over the year. We size every system based on 12 months of actual power bills, not a rule-of-thumb formula. Properties in this area running $300 to $500 per month typically land in the 10 to 14 kW range. Properties running $500 to $800 per month, with a shop or secondary loads, usually need 14 to 20 kW to make a meaningful dent. Typical Load Profiles We Design For Near Lethbridge

Heated Shop Plus Residential Home

A home and a 40x60 heated shop on the same meter is one of the most common setups we see in Lethbridge County. The shop alone, with in-floor heat, lighting, and a compressor running through winter, can pull $400 to $600 per month. Combined with the house, total monthly bills often land between $600 and $900, which typically points to a 16 to 18 kW system to offset 70 to 80 percent of usage.

Grain Storage and Handling Operation

Properties with grain bins, augers, and aeration fans carry significant seasonal loads concentrated in fall and spring. Monthly bills for a grain handling setup can swing from $200 in a quiet month to over $900 during heavy aeration or drying periods. A 14 to 20 kW system sized against a full 12-month bill average typically offsets 60 to 75 percent of annual consumption for this type of operation.

Commercial Shop or Light Industrial Building

Light commercial properties and trade shops in the area, running multiple compressors, welders, and HVAC equipment during business hours, are a good match for solar because the loads peak during daylight. A shop pulling $500 to $800 per month in operating costs typically needs 12 to 16 kW to cover daytime consumption and reduce evening draw. The City of Lethbridge's interconnection process applies to commercial properties on the municipal utility just as it does for residential accounts.

City of Lethbridge Electric Utility Interconnection

Lethbridge runs its own municipal electric utility, which means the interconnection process is handled through the city rather than a provincial wire service like FortisAlberta or ENMAX. For shop and outbuilding solar, this is a micro-generation application submitted to the City of Lethbridge Electric Utility. Approval typically takes two to six weeks from the date of submission. We handle the application on your behalf. That includes preparing the single-line diagram, completing the utility forms, and coordinating any technical review the city requires before approving your system for grid connection. Once the application is approved, the city installs a bi-directional meter that tracks what your system produces and what you draw from the grid. Credits for excess production roll forward against future bills under Alberta's micro-generation regulation. If your shop meter base or service entrance doesn't meet the city's requirements, we'll flag that during the design review before the application goes in. There are no surprises mid-project. Rebates and Incentives Available in Lethbridge

Alberta Micro-Generation Regulation

Under Alberta's micro-generation regulation, excess electricity your system sends to the grid is credited against future power bills rather than paid out in cash. Credits roll forward month to month, which means summer overproduction offsets winter shortfalls. The City of Lethbridge installs a bi-directional meter to track the two-way flow once your system is approved and energized.

Federal Clean Technology Investment Tax Credit

Farm operations and incorporated businesses may be eligible for the federal Clean Technology Investment Tax Credit, which covers a percentage of eligible solar equipment costs. This credit applies to commercial and agricultural operations, not personal residential systems, so it's worth discussing with your accountant if the shop or outbuilding is tied to a registered business or farm operation. Eligibility rules and rates are set federally and can change with budget cycles.
